华信教育资源网
面向对象程序设计基础教程——Visual Basic语言
作   译   者:郭字周,李俊,尹貹彬等 出 版 日 期:2014-02-01
出   版   社:电子工业出版社 维   护   人:冉哲 
书   代   号:G0221940 I S B N:9787121221941

图书简介:

本书面向普通高校学生,以培养计算思维能力为目标而编写。第1章介绍计算思维的概念。第2章介绍Visual Basic开发环境,以及经常使用的窗口。第3章介绍创建一个Visual Basic应用程序所需要的步骤。第4章介绍数据类型、运算符和表达式。第5章介绍Visual Basic中经常使用的输入、输出方法。第6章介绍程序的三种控制结构(顺序结构、选择结构、循环结构)。第7章介绍数组的概念以及使用方法。第8章介绍过程、函数的创建以及使用方法。第9章介绍Visual Basic中的常用控件。第10章介绍键盘与鼠标事件。第11章介绍菜单创建和菜单编程。第12章介绍文件操作。本书提供配套教学资源,可登录华信教育资源网(http://www.hxedu.com.cn)注册后下载,或登录网站:http://cc.hbu.cn/vb。
您的专属联系人更多
配套资源 图书内容 样章/电子教材 图书评价
  • 配 套 资 源
    图书特别说明:

    本书资源

    本书暂无资源

    会员上传本书资源

  • 图 书 内 容

    内容简介

    本书面向普通高校学生,以培养计算思维能力为目标而编写。第1章介绍计算思维的概念。第2章介绍Visual Basic开发环境,以及经常使用的窗口。第3章介绍创建一个Visual Basic应用程序所需要的步骤。第4章介绍数据类型、运算符和表达式。第5章介绍Visual Basic中经常使用的输入、输出方法。第6章介绍程序的三种控制结构(顺序结构、选择结构、循环结构)。第7章介绍数组的概念以及使用方法。第8章介绍过程、函数的创建以及使用方法。第9章介绍Visual Basic中的常用控件。第10章介绍键盘与鼠标事件。第11章介绍菜单创建和菜单编程。第12章介绍文件操作。 本书提供配套教学资源,可登录华信教育资源网(http://www.hxedu.com.cn)注册后下载,或登录网站:http://cc.hbu.cn/vb。

    图书详情

    ISBN:9787121221941
    开 本:16开
    页 数:264
    字 数:422

    本书目录

    第1章  绪论 1
    第2章  Visual Basic简介 10
    2.1  Visual Basic概述 10
    2.1.1  Visual Basic版本介绍 10
    2.1.2  Visual Basic特点 10
    2.2  Visual Basic集成开发环境 11
    2.2.1  启动与退出 11
    2.2.2  菜单栏 12
    2.2.3  工具栏 15
    2.2.4  工具箱 16
    2.2.5  常用窗口 16
    2.3  类和对象 21
    2.3.1  类和对象概念 21
    2.3.2  属性 21
    2.3.3  事件 23
    2.3.3  方法 24
    习题2 25
    第3章  创建简单Visual Basic应用程序 27
    3.1  语句 27
    3.2  创建简单应用程序 29
    3.3  调试 34
    3.3.1  程序的错误类型 34
    3.3.2  调试概念 36
    3.3.3  单步跟踪 37
    3.3.4  断点 39
    习题3 40
    第4章  数据类型、运算符和表达式 41
    4.1  数据类型 41
    4.1.1  标识符 41
    4.1.2  基本数据类型 41
    4.2  常量和变量 45
    4.2.1  常量 45
    4.2.2  变量 47
    4.2.3  变量的作用域 49
    4.3  运算符、表达式 52
    4.3.1  算术运算符与表达式 52
    4.3.2  字符串运算符与表达式 54
    4.3.3  日期运算符与表达式 54
    4.3.4  关系运算符与表达式 55
    4.3.5  逻辑运算符与表达式 56
    4.3.6  运算符的优先级 56
    4.4  常用内部函数 57
    4.4.1  函数的概念及使用 57
    4.4.2  数学函数 59
    4.4.3  字符串函数 59
    4.4.4  日期与时间函数 60
    4.4.5  转换函数 60
    习题4 60
    第5章  输入、输出 63
    5.1  输入 63
    5.1.1  文本框输入 63
    5.1.2  InputBox函数 65
    5.2  输出 66
    5.2.1  Print方法 66
    5.2.2  MsgBox函数 70
    5.2.3  利用标签输出 73
    习题5 74
    第6章  控制结构 76
    6.1  顺序结构 76
    6.2  选择结构 78
    6.2.1  单行条件语句 79
    6.2.2  块结构条件语句 84
    6.2.3  IIF函数 94
    6.2.4  多分支控制语句 95
    6.3  循环结构 98
    6.3.1  For语句 99
    6.3.2  Do…Loop语句 104
    6.3.3  While语句 113
    6.3.4  循环举例 114
    习题6 125
    第7章  数组 130
    7.1  一维数组 130
    7.1.1  一维数组定义 130
    7.1.2  一维数组遍历 131
    7.1.3  一维数组举例 135
    7.2  二维数组 143
    7.2.1  二维数组定义 143
    7.2.2  二维数组遍历 144
    7.2.3  二维数组举例 146
    7.3  动态数组 153
    7.4  数组初始化 155
    习题7 156
    第8章  过程、函数 159
    8.1  Sub过程 159
    8.1.1  Sub过程定义 159
    8.1.2  Sub过程调用 161
    8.2  Function过程 162
    8.2.1  Function过程定义 162
    8.2.2  Function过程调用 163
    8.3  参数传递 164
    8.3.1  形参、实参 164
    8.3.2  参数传递 165
    8.3.3  数组作为参数 171
    8.3.4  控件参数 174
    8.4  嵌套与递归 175
    习题8 178
    第9章  常用控件 181
    9.1  窗体 181
    9.2  标签 184
    9.3  文本框 185
    9.4  按钮 189
    9.5  图片框 190
    9.6  复选框 194
    9.7  单选按钮和框架 196
    9.7.1  单选按钮 196
    9.7.2  框架 198
    9.8  列表框、组合框 199
    9.8.1  列表框 199
    9.8.2  组合框 203
    9.9  滚动条 204
    9.10  时钟 205
    9.11  文件系统控件 206
    9.12  图像控件 207
    9.13  图形控件 208
    9.14  通用对话框 210
    9.15  控件数组 214
    习题9 217
    第10章  键盘与鼠标事件 221
    10.1  键盘事件 221
    10.1.1  KeyPress事件 221
    10.1.2  KeyDown、KeyUp事件 222
    10.2  鼠标事件 223
    10.2.1  MouseDown、MouseUp事件 223
    10.2.2  MouseMove事件 224
    习题10 226
    第11章  菜单 228
    11.1  菜单设计 228
    11.1.1  菜单编辑器 228
    11.1.2  下拉式菜单 230
    11.1.3  弹出式菜单 230
    11.1.4  菜单控件数组 232
    11.2  菜单项的控制 233
    11.2.1  有效性控制 233
    11.2.2  可见性控制 234
    习题11 234
    第12章  文件 236
    12.1  文件基本概念 236
    12.1.1  文件的分类 236
    12.1.2  打开文件 237
    12.1.3  关闭文件 238
    12.2  常用文件操作语句和函数 238
    12.2.1  文件打开、操作函数 238
    12.2.2  文件操作语句和函数 240
    12.3  顺序文件操作 243
    12.3.1  顺序文件写操作 243
    12.3.2  顺序文件读操作 245
    12.4  随机文件 247
    12.4.1  随机文件写操作 247
    12.4.2  随机文件读操作 248
    12.5  二进制文件 249
    习题12 250
    附录A  ASCII码表 252
    附录B  Visual Basic常用系统常量 254
    展开

    前     言

    前    言
    Visual Basic是由微软公司开发的面向对象的事件驱动编程语言,它源自BASIC语言。Visual Basic拥有图形用户界面和快速应用程序开发系统工具,它以简单易学又不缺乏专业性能而著称。在Visual Basic开发环境中,提供了丰富的控件,让用户可以轻松地创建出友好的界面,使用DAO、RDO、ADO连接数据库,创建ActiveX控件,从而快速建立一个应用程序。
    本书面向普通高校学生,以培养计算思维为目标而编写。编者根据多年的教学经验,从初学者的角度分析问题、解决问题,逐步培养学生计算思维,提高学生独立分析问题、解决问题的能力,重点放在的方法的培养。参加过软件开发的人都知道,计算思维是最重要的,其次才是计算机语言的驾驭能力。所以在编写过程中,本书特别注重以下几点:
    站在“程序设计盲”的角度去分析问题,让初学者更容易接受。
    根据多年教学经验,总结出计算思维培养过程中的主要障碍,在编写程序过程中,提出了“三步法”原则。
    案例分析时,应站在人的角度,而不是计算机的角度进行。
    第1章介绍计算思维的概念、以及计算思维与计算机课程关系。第2章着重讲解Visual Basic开发环境,以及经常使用的窗口。第3章讲解创建一个Visual Basic应用程序所需要的步骤。第4章讲解数据类型、运算符和表达式。第5章讲解Visual Basic中经常使用的输入、输出方法。第6章讲解程序的三种控制结构(顺序结构、选择结构、循环结构)。第7章讲解数组的概念以及使用方法。第8章讲解过程、函数的创建以及使用方法。第9章讲解Visual Basic中的常用控件。第10章讲解键盘与鼠标事件。第11章讲解菜单创建和菜单编程。第12章讲解文件操作。
    本书由郭字周主编,张小莉主审。其中郭字周编写第1~4章,李俊编写第5~6章,尹胜彬编写第7~8章,武戎编写第9~10章,刘玉玲编写第11~12章。参编人员均从事“面向对象程序设计——Visual Basic语言”教学多年,具有丰富的教学经验。
    本书提供配套教学资源,可登录华信教育资源网(http://www.hxedu.com.cn)注册后下载,或登录网站:http://cc.hbu.cn/vb。
    本书适合作为高等学校理工类非计算机专业教材,也可作为Visual Basic编程初学者入门教材。
    由于作者水平有限,书中难免有不妥和疏漏之处,敬请广大读者指正。
    
    
    编  者  
    2013年12月
    展开

    作者简介

    本书暂无作者简介
  • 样 章 试 读
  • 图 书 评 价
华信教育资源网